Burger Restaurant Coming to Old Garden District Space at 14th and S Streets, NW

IMG_0877

And in non snowsanity related news – a burger joint is coming to the Old Garden District space located at 14th and S Streets, NW. This is the space that was gonna have a creperie for a hot second. Thanks to all the readers who sent in the word. One reader writes:

“The old garden district at 14th and S will be re-imagined as a beer garden (I’ve always said DC is sorely missing this!) Apparently it will be started by a twenty-something Bates College grad.”

The liquor application says:

“New restaurant serving hamburgers and french fries with 15 seats. Occupancy load of 170. Request a sidewalk cafe with a seating capacity of 67 and summer garden with a seating capacity of 63″.

Sounds pretty sweet, yeah?
